Vliv ochlazování austenitických ocelí při svařování metodou TIG

Abstract

This thesis investigates the effects of cooling on austenitic steels during TIG welding. The introduction provides an analysis of steels with an austenitic structure and the methods used to weld them. The experimental section describes the construction of a cooling device and the TIG welding of four specimens under various cooling conditions. The objective was to assess the effect of cooling on the quality of the weld and the entire welding process. To this end, temperature field measurements and standardized destructive and non-destructive tests of welded joints were used, such as visual inspection, penetrant testing, microscopic and macroscopic examination, and microhardness testing.
